Hi experts,
I have a form acting as a user exit, so i cannot change the declarations.
In my case in one of the parameters i have a table, such as this:
Form EXAMPLEFORM using tableparameter TYPE any.
I want to loop this table into a declared structure, but i cannot do this c'ause the program doesn't compile or gets a dump error.
I know wich is the table structure, is CE0ECHE.
I have read some examples here but are not the same case....
Can someone help me with this please?
Thanks!!!

2013 Dec 19 9:38 AM
Artur,
declare a field symbol as type any table.
assing your formal parameter to it.
now you can loop on the field symbol which is declared as table.

2013 Dec 19 9:22 AM
Do like this
data:lt_t001 type standard table of t001.
select * up to 100 rows from t001 into table lt_t001.
PERFORM get_directory_browse using lt_t001.
*----------------------------------------------------------------------*
FORM get_directory_browse
using pt_t001 type any .
data:lwa_t001 like line of t001,
lt_t001 type standard table of t001.
lt_t001[] = pt_t001.
loop at lt_t001 into lwa_t001.
endloop.
ENDFORM.
